UK PS3 Launch Spoilt by Mugging Fears

Despite intentions for a large number of stores to open their doors at midnight in order to begin selling Sony's new console to die-hard Playstation fans, this has been forced to change after local authorities feared that police won't be able to cope with the crowds. Because of this, the only shop in London set to open at midnight to sell the PS3 will be Virgin's Megastore on Oxford Street - not a single HMV store in London will be opening at midnight. Throughout the rest of the UK there are still plans for 50 stores to open their doors at midnight, but this number is gradually shrinking as other areas follow the example set by London. GAME is advising that customers who have pre-ordered a PS3 contact their local branch to check whether it will be open or not. The main problem that police fear is that young gamers may find themselves being mugged of their new £425 console.
